Frequently Asked Questions about Burleith-Leighton

How much are Studio apartments in Burleith-Leighton?

There are currently 312 Studio Apartments in Burleith-Leighton with rent ranges from $875 to $2,379 with an average price of $1,639.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Burleith-Leighton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Burleith-Leighton ranges from $263 to $3,220 with an average monthly rent of $1,497.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Burleith-Leighton c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Burleith-Leighton range from $751 to $3,944.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,771.

How expensive are Burleith-Leighton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 117 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Burleith-Leighton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$814 to $3,600 - averaging $1,969 for the location.
